Understanding the Raw Garlic and Inflammation Connection
Garlic has long been revered for its health benefits, but confusion can arise regarding its effect on inflammation. The short answer, backed by scientific research, is that raw garlic is not inflammatory; rather, it is a potent anti-inflammatory agent. This powerful effect is attributed to the presence of key bioactive compounds, particularly allicin, which is at its peak when garlic is raw.
The Science Behind Garlic's Anti-Inflammatory Power
When a raw garlic clove is crushed, chopped, or chewed, a compound called alliin reacts with the enzyme alliinase to form allicin. Allicin is the superstar compound responsible for garlic's distinctive aroma and many of its medicinal properties.
Here’s how allicin and other sulfur-containing compounds work to fight inflammation:
- Inhibiting Pro-inflammatory Cytokines: Studies show that allicin and diallyl disulfide (another sulfur compound in garlic) can limit the effects of pro-inflammatory cytokines, which are proteins that drive inflammation in the body.
- Regulating Inflammatory Responses: Research suggests that garlic can modulate immune system responses. For example, some studies found that garlic extracts can stimulate the production of anti-inflammatory cytokines, like IL-10, while reducing pro-inflammatory ones, such as TNF-α and IL-6.
- Boosting Antioxidant Activity: Chronic inflammation is often linked to oxidative stress. Raw garlic is rich in antioxidants that neutralize harmful free radicals and protect cells from damage, which in turn helps to reduce overall inflammation.
The Effect of Preparation: Raw vs. Cooked Garlic
The method of preparing garlic significantly affects its anti-inflammatory potency. A key finding is that heat can destroy or diminish the concentration of allicin and other beneficial sulfur compounds.
To maximize the anti-inflammatory benefits, it is recommended to consume raw garlic or to let it sit for about 10 minutes after chopping or crushing before adding it to a dish. This resting period allows the alliinase enzyme time to generate the maximum amount of allicin.
| Feature | Raw Garlic | Cooked Garlic | 
|---|---|---|
| Allicin Concentration | High. The crushing process activates the enzyme alliinase, creating allicin immediately. | Low. The heat rapidly inactivates the alliinase enzyme, preventing allicin from forming. | 
| Anti-Inflammatory Effect | Stronger. The higher concentration of allicin and other active compounds provides a more potent anti-inflammatory response. | Lesser. While some anti-inflammatory properties remain, the effect is reduced due to the loss of key heat-sensitive compounds. | 
| Flavor | Pungent, sharp, and intense. | Milder, sweeter, and more mellow. | 
| Digestive Impact | May cause digestive upset, heartburn, or gas in some sensitive individuals, especially in large amounts. | Generally easier to digest than its raw counterpart. | 
Beyond Inflammation: Other Benefits of Raw Garlic
Raw garlic’s benefits extend well beyond combating inflammation. Regular consumption has been linked to numerous positive health outcomes:
- Heart Health: Studies indicate that garlic can help reduce blood pressure and lower cholesterol levels, contributing to improved cardiovascular health.
- Immune System Support: The antimicrobial, antiviral, and antifungal properties of allicin help bolster the immune system, potentially reducing the severity of common colds and flu.
- Antioxidant Power: Raw garlic's high antioxidant content helps combat oxidative stress, which is a major factor in aging and the development of chronic diseases.
- Detoxification: Raw garlic assists the body in detoxifying by helping to eliminate heavy metals and other toxins, supporting liver function.
Precautions for Raw Garlic Consumption
While the anti-inflammatory benefits of raw garlic are clear, it is crucial to be mindful of potential side effects, particularly with excessive consumption. A single clove is a good starting point for most people. Large amounts can lead to digestive discomfort, such as heartburn, gas, or bloating. For individuals on blood-thinning medication, consult a healthcare provider before increasing garlic intake, as it has natural anticoagulant properties.
